RE: Pilot Power or Pilot Power 2CT
I wouldn't spend the extra money for 2ct's if you are just using your bike as a daily commuter. I have 2ct's now and I don't think they lasted that long. I am thinking about getting something different for my daily commutes and sticking with the 2ct's for track and twisties. The 2ct's rocked on the track. I didn't feel them slip at all. I've had mine for 2 months and use my bike as a commuter. I did one track day on them along with twisties on Sunday's. I have maybe another couple of weeks on them.
This is all subjective to your riding style and preference. I can't get a good measure on tire wear because I've had bad luck with flats. I expected them to last 4 months though. I'd be curious to hear others experience with them. I might be expecting too much.

RE: Pilot Power or Pilot Power 2CT
I'll chime in..........
I have run Qualifiers, 208 GP A's, and Pilot Powers (Standards) on mine.
Question is....... Track? Street? Commuting? What is the use of your bike? If track, you "might" be able to use the 2CT's, if not, the standard Pilot Powers will work fine. If commuting, look into something like the Pirelli Diablo Stradas. Seriously. I can drag knee pucks with my heavy *** Aprilia wearing Stradas and they last longer than anything else I have ever run.
My CBR will be seeing nothing but Pilot Powers from now on. The only way I can justify the extra funds for 2CT's is track only.

RE: Pilot Power or Pilot Power 2CT
well I got PP and buddy got the 2ct....yea both great tires...and 2ct warm up quicker...but for daily riding the 2ct's arent the greatest...he has a little over 1000 miles and a wear strip 2 inches in the center...also he noticed that even though the sides are softer and the middle is a medium compound....high speed and wheelies....tears up ALL tires.....
